What is Coumadin?

Coumadin has active ingredients of warfarin sodium. It is often used in blood clots. eHealthMe is studying from 133,228 Coumadin users. Check the latest studies of Coumadin.

What is Dexedrine?

Dexedrine has active ingredients of dextroamphetamine sulfate. It is often used in attention deficit hyperactivity disorder. eHealthMe is studying from 4,735 Dexedrine users. Check the latest studies of Dexedrine.

How the study uses the data?

The study uses data from the FDA. It is based on warfarin sodium and dextroamphetamine sulfate (the active ingredients of Coumadin and Dexedrine, respectively), and Coumadin and Dexedrine (the brand names). Other drugs that have the same active ingredients (e.g. generic drugs) are not considered. Dosage of drugs is not considered in the study.
